Sachko made it to the main draw of the ATP tournament in Sofia

Marchenko lost in the qualifying final

The first racket of Ukraine Vitaly Sachko made it to the main draw of the tournament ATP 250 in Bulgarian Sofia.

In the qualifying final, Sachko beat Nerman Fatić from Bosnia and Herzegovina in an almost 3-hour match. The Ukrainian lost the first game in a tiebreaker, but managed to turn the tide of the meeting and win the next two sets – 6:3, 7:6.

Sachko will play in the ATP tournament for the fourth time in his career and for the second time in 2023. In May, Vitaly lost in the first round of the ATP 250 tournament in Geneva.

Another representative of Ukraine – Ilya Marchenko — failed to reach the main draw of the competition in Bulgaria. In the final qualifying match, he lost to the Frenchman Terence Atman in two sets.


  • ATP 250. Sofia, Bulgaria. Qualification. The final

Vitaly Sachko (Ukraine, 3) — Nerman Fatic (Bosnia and Herzegovina, 7) 2:1 (6:7(2), 6:3, 7:6(7))

Terence Atman (France, 1) — Ilya Marchenko (Ukraine, 5) 2:0 (7:6(3), 7:5)
